Understanding the Basics of Growth

In terms of health, you can generally consider your child to be growing well if they are "eating well, sleeping well, and having healthy bowel movements." If growth is slow without any specific health issues, it is necessary to check both genetic factors and the child's current condition.

We look into family history and, in particular, assess the child's 'Yin-Blood' (Yin-Hyeol) status. A deficiency in Yin-Blood is like having a strong fire in a furnace but not enough fuel; the child has sufficient Yang energy to grow, but often experiences slow growth and the accumulation of internal heat due to a lack of corresponding Yin-Blood.

Treatment Process
STEP 01

Precise Diagnosis

We analyze the underlying causes using multi-faceted methods, including InBody analysis, pulse diagnosis, tongue examination, abdominal palpation, and autonomic nervous system testing.

STEP 02

Root Cause Resolution

We prescribe customized herbal medicine to resolve the root causes of growth delay and promote healthy development.

STEP 03

Body Alignment & Therapy

We correct body imbalances through Chuna manual therapy (including craniosacral therapy) and provide concurrent acupuncture and cupping treatments.

STEP 04

Continuous Management

We support healthy growth through at least 3 months of intensive treatment and guidance on lifestyle habits.
